Severskiy plant’s net loss exceeds 1.22bn

The net loss of Severskiy Pipe Works (asset of Pipe Metallurgical Company/TMK) exceeded 1.22 billion RUR in 2009, whereas in 2008, the company made 1.4 billion RUR in profit. The company’s loss amounted to 330.66 million RUR in the third quarter of 2009 and to 218.59 million RUR in the fourth quarter of 2009. According to the plant’s official statement, the dropping profits had to do with reduced sales revenues, which, in their turn, were caused by shrinking sales volumes and declining prices. In addition, the company had to pay more in terms of loan interest.

Pnevmostroymashina undergoes bankruptcy proceedings

The creditors of Pnevmostroymashina decided that the company should undergo bankruptcy proceedings and appointed Eduard Chu the company’s trustee in bankruptcy. This decision was taken at the creditors’ first meeting. According to Pnevmostroymashina’s official representative Pavel Anokhin, the creditors, who have over 96% of the votes, supported the company management’s proposal regarding bankruptcy proceedings and having Eduard Chu as the trustee in bankruptcy. Ural Airlines to operate flight to Rome on Sundays

Ural Airlines informed the Ministry for International and Foreign Economic Relations of Sverdlovsk Region that the company was going to launch a scheduled flight from Yekaterinburg to Rome and back on May 2, 2010. The flight will be operated every Sunday. The Ministry reports Italy has been one of Sverdlovsk Region’s key economic partners for the last few years, so the current business and tourist ties between the two territories are bound to secure good demand for the flight.

VTB Group’s lending portfolio shrinks 6.8%

VTB Group (headed by VTB, Russia’s second largest bank), cut back on its loans to businesses by 6.8% in 2009. The figures decreased down to 2.1 trillion RUR (if calculated in accordance with the IAS), RIA Novosti reports. VTB says the portfolio shrank due to the Russian companies’ declining demand. At the same time, the bank’s share of the retail market rose up to 10.2% in 2009 against 8.8% in 2008, the company reports. VTB Group’s retail lending portfolio grew by 12.5% last year and reached 435.3 billion RUR, which was a lot better than the market’s average.

Ural Airlines resumes flight to Spain

Ural Airlines is about to resume its summer flight to Spain. The Yekaterinburg-Barcelona flight will be operated twice a week, that is, every Tuesday and Saturday, between May 29, 2010 and October 2, 2010. The plane leaves Yekaterinburg at 5:05 AM and arrives in Barcelona at 7:15 AM. The flight lasts six hours and ten minutes. All the flights are operated on an A320 aircraft; the passengers can choose between economy and business class tickets. Ural Airlines is actually the only carrier to offer regular connection between the Urals and Spain.

Strikers at Ford to face liability

The participants and coordinators of a strike at Ford’s plant in Vsevolozhsk, Leningrad Region will have to sustain a disciplinary punishment, the spokesperson for Ford Motors Company informed RosBusinessConsulting. The company says the strike was illegitimate because the administration was only informed of the event within some very short time of the strike’s actual start. This preliminary strike of Ford’s workers began on March 25, 2010 (3 PM Moscow time). The plant’s employees want some changes in the enterprise’s collective agreement and a pay rise.
